Abstract

The utility model discloses a feeding platform positioning device of an automatic die cutting machine. The feeding platform positioning device comprises a fixing frame fixedly arranged on a main machine tool, a middle hollow block plate is arranged on the fixing frame and provided with an X-direction guide rail, an X-direction movable platform is installed on the X-direction guide rail, a Y-direction guide rail is arranged on the X-direction movable platform, a Y-direction movable platform is installed on the Y-direction guide rail, a fixing plate is arranged at the lower end of the Y-direction movable platform and passes through the X-direction movable platform to be connected with a stepping motor device, a feeding platform support rod is arranged on the stepping motor device and passes through the X-direction movable platform and the Y-direction movable platform to be connected with a feeding platform, an X-direction screw rod adjusting device corresponding to the X-direction guide rail is arranged between the X-direction movable platform and the block plate, and a Y-direction screw rod adjusting device corresponding to the Y-direction guide rail is arranged between the Y-direction movable platform and the X-direction movable platform. The feeding platform positioning device is convenient to operate and rapid in horizontal positioning.

The specific embodiment
Referring to figs. 1 through Fig. 2, it comprises the fixed mount 1 that is fixed on the main body lathe rollway positioner of a kind of automatic die cutter of the utility model, the piece plate 2 of hollow out in the middle of bolt is connected with on the said fixed mount 1; Directions X guide rail 3 is installed on the piece plate 2, and said directions X guide rail 3 is provided with slide block 31, and directions X moving platform 4 is installed on the slide block 31; Said directions X moving platform 4 is provided with Y traversing guide 5, and Y traversing guide 5 can be selected the inner concave shape guide rail for use, also can select the guide rail that has slide block for use; Y direction moving platform 6 is installed on the Y traversing guide 5; The lower end snail of Y direction moving platform 6 ties and is connected to fixed head 7, and fixed head 7 is a strip piece plate, and fixed head 7 passes directions X moving platform 4 and is connected with stepper motor device 8; Stepper motor device 8 includes stepper motor 82; Be connected with reversing arrangement 83 on the stepper motor 82,, be connected with vertical expansion link 84 on the reversing arrangement 83 so that rotatablely moving of motor vertical direction is converted into rotatablely moving of horizontal direction; The rotatablely moving of horizontal direction after the switching-over can drive vertical expansion link 84 and move down in vertical direction; Vertical expansion link 84 upper ends are connected with vertical lift platform 85, are connecting four rollway support bars 81 on the vertical lift platform 85, and rollway support bar 81 passes directions X moving platform 4, Y direction moving platform 6 is connected with rollway 9; In addition, be provided with the directions X spiro rod regulating device 10 corresponding between directions X moving platform 4 and the piece plate 2, be provided with the Y direction spiro rod regulating device 11 corresponding between Y direction moving platform 6 and the directions X moving platform 4 with Y traversing guide 5 with directions X guide rail 3.Directions X spiro rod regulating device 10 comprises the directions X piece crab bolt seat 21 that is installed in piece plate 2 drift angle places and is installed in the directions X moving platform nut seat 41 on the directions X moving platform 4, is connected with directions X adjusting screw(rod) 101 between directions X piece crab bolt seat 21 and the directions X moving platform nut seat 41.Through turn adjusting screw(rod) 101, the Y direction moving platform 6 that just can drive on directions X moving platform 4 and the directions X moving platform 4 thereof is made move left and right at directions X.Y direction spiro rod regulating device 11 comprises the Y direction X moving platform nut seat 42 that is installed in directions X moving platform 4 sides and is installed in the Y direction Y moving platform nut seat 61 on the Y direction moving platform 6, is connected with Y direction adjusting screw(rod) 111 between Y direction X moving platform nut seat 42 and the Y direction Y moving platform nut seat 61.Through rotation adjusting screw rod 111, just can drive Y direction moving platform 6 and on directions X moving platform 4, make the Y direction and move, promptly move forward and backward.
Further, said block of plate 2 is provided with the fixture 22 that is used for fixing the directions X moving platform 4 behind the setting.Fixture 22 is positioned at the side of directions X guide rail 3 near piece plate 2 edges, and fixture 22 comprises fastening stripe board 221 and tightening knob 222, and fastening stripe board 221 is provided with groove.When the position of directions X moving platform 4 set up good after, tightening knob 222 is aimed at the screw of directions X moving platforms 4 sides and is screwed, be clamped in the groove on the fastening stripe board 221 until tightening knob 222.The directions X moving platform 4 that is arranged so that of fixture 22 offset can not occur in the middle of follow-up work, guaranteed the accurate of location.
Further, said Y direction moving platform 6 is provided with the fixture 62 that is used for fixing the Y direction moving platform 6 behind the setting.Fixture 62 is a tightening knob; Y direction moving platform 6 is provided with the groove of laying tightening knob; After the position of Y direction moving platform 4 is set up well, tightening knob is screwed in the screw corresponding on the directions X moving platform 4 so that Y direction moving platform 6 is clamped on the directions X moving platform 4.The Y direction moving platform 6 that is arranged so that of fixture 62 can offset not occur with respect to directions X moving platform 4 in follow-up work, guaranteed the accurate of Y direction location.
Further; Move forward and backward with respect to directions X moving platform 4 in order to cooperate the fixed head 7 that passes directions X moving platform 4 and rollway support bar 8 to follow Y direction moving platform 6; The groove that is used for should be the Y direction that is provided with on the directions X moving platform 4 through the hole of fixed head 7 and rollway support bar 8; The structure of hollow out in the middle of perhaps directions X moving platform 4 adopts, only staying Y traversing guide 5 is installed is non-engraved structure with fixture 62 corresponding screw places.
The Y direction moving platform that this product will be equipped with rollway is arranged on the directions X moving platform; Through the directions X spiro rod regulating device directions X moving platform is carried out the directions X set positions; Through Y direction spiro rod regulating device Y direction moving platform is carried out Y direction set positions, move in X, Y direction with the rollway that drives on the Y direction moving platform, after adjust X, Y direction position; Through fixture fixedly X, Y direction moving platform, finally realize the location of rollway at horizontal level.
